About This Item

Danbury, CT: Medallic Art Co.. Obverse of the medal presents an aerial view of the "modern city of Pittsburgh." At the foreground is the point at which the Allegheny and Monongahela Rivers converge. The site of Fort Pitt and the city's central business district (The Golden Triangle) and modern skyline are in the background. Reverse of the piece depicts the plan for Fort Pitt and shows the convergence of the Ohio, Allegheny, and Monongahela Rivers. Also seen are the official seals of the City of Pittsburgh, the County of Allegheny, and the Pittsburgh Bicentennial. 2 15/16" in D. A large bronze medal, the official commemorative medal of Pittsburgh's 200th birthday. . Fine. No Binding. 1958.
